Hi, I've got this pedal. The bees come from the High knob, you better keep it at minimum and play with the treble in your amp. Also gain shouldn't go beyond 1 o'clock, it becomes mushy. Below that, you got enough distortion. If you mix it up with a little overdrive in the amp it really starts to shine. My settings: Freq at 2 o'clock while Mid at 3 o'clock, High at cero, Low at 10, Gain at 12 o'clock.

I have this pedal. The trick is to dial back on the "High" knob. I've literally got that knob almost on minimum. The Gain I have set to about 1 o'clock and the Volume at about 10 o'clock. Then I route the output into a TS-808 Tubescreamer. Then into a Marshall tube amp. Sounds absolutely awesome, both for chugging chords, and also a great high-gain creamy solo tones with amazing sustain. Guitar is a 1990s Charvel-Jackson Model-3 HSS, with the Jackson stock humbucker.

Bass: 2:00, mids: 1:00, mid. freq.: 10:00, highs: basically off, gain: never above 9:00. When it is set any higher than that you definitely start getting the can of bees sound. Keep the gain low (by this pedal's definition of low), and the highs nearly off and this pedal actually does sound good.
